Ingredients
+ Añadir a un menú- Pumpkin peeled and deseeded 1000 g
- Serrano ham 40 g sliced and 40 g chopped 80 g
- Onion peeled 180 g
- Rice dry 25 g
- Extra virgin olive oil 30 g
- Parsley 3 g
- Salt adjust to the ham 1 g
- Water 1000 g

Method
-
Preheat the oven to 180°C. Spread 40 g of ham in slices on a parchment-lined tray and bake for 8–12 minutes, checking from minute 8. Cool so it becomes crisp.
-
Chop the onion and soften in a saucepan with the oil for 5 minutes. Add the pumpkin in 2 cm cubes and cook for another 5 minutes.
-
Add the rice, remaining 40 g of chopped ham, water and salt. Cover and simmer gently for 20–25 minutes until the rice and pumpkin are very tender.
-
Remove from the heat and blend with a stick blender. Divide between four bowls, break the crisp ham into flakes and add it with the chopped parsley.
